A K-12 educational institution in South Holland, IL is seeking a qualified School Psychologist to support students across elementary, middle, and high school levels. This contract position offers an opportunity to work with a diverse student population, including those with autism, during the upcoming school year.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ive psychological assessments for K-12 students
  • Collaborate with educators and families to develop Individualized Education Programs (IEPs)
  • Provide behavioral and emotional support tailored to students with autism and other special needs
  • Participate in multidisciplinary team meetings to develop intervention strategies
  • Monitor progress and adjust interventions as necessary
  • Assist with crisis interventions and promote positive school climate initiatives

Qualifications:

  • Valid School Psychologist certification or license appropriate for K-12 settings
  • Experience working with elementary, middle, and high school students
  • Proven expertise in supporting students with autism spectrum disorder
  • Strong assessment and counseling skills
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with education professionals and families
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ills
